Expression of PBPs starts 3 days before adult eclosion in L. dispar (Vogt et al., 1989) and 35 10 h before adult emergence in M. sexta (Vogt et al., 1993), with the expression being induced by the decline in ecdysteroid levels. It has been estimated that in L. dispar PBPs undergo a combined steady-state turnover of 8 x 107 molecules per hour per sensillum (Vogt et al., 1989). [Pg.451]

To verify in vitro results, we have also developed an in vivo assay for L. dispar PTTH (52, Thyagaraja et al, in preparation). This assay is comparable to larval assays develop for Af. sexta (56 and B. mori (58) and uses last instar female larvae. Neck ligation prior to day 7, the day when a small pre-peak in hemolymph ecdysteroid titer appears, blocks further development. Injection of PTTH-containing extracts posterior to the ligation, including post-embryonic egg extract, reinitiates development and subsequent pupation. Attempts to develop an in vivo assay comparable to the pupal-adult B. mori assay (5B were unsuccessful, since brain removal as close as 15 min post-pupal ecdysis failed to block L. dispar female adult development (Thyagaraja et a/., unpublished results). [Pg.29]

The molting hormones (MHs) and ecdysteroids of the tobacco hornworm (Manduca sexta L.) at different developmental stages are discussed. From this insect nine ecdysteroids have been identified and each has varying degrees of MH activity. There are also qualitative and quantitative differences at the various stages. 20-Hydroxyecdysone is the major ecdysteroid of Manduca during pupal-adult development at peak titer of Mh activity. Five days later, 20,26-dihydroxyecdysone is the major ecdysteroid. [Pg.187]
